Limestone is a carbonate sedimentary rock that is often composed of the skeletal fragments of marine organisms such as coral, foraminifera, and molluscs.Its major materials are the minerals calcite and aragonite, which are different crystal forms of calcium carbonate (CaCO 3).A closely related rock is dolomite, which contains a high percentage of the mineral dolomite, CaMg(CO 3) 2.

Limestone mining is done out in the open. Once studies show the existence of stone at the site, the extraction is made by separating the rock in quarry benches and dividing it into blocks. Before beginning the quarrying process, a resource analysis is made.

How is limestone extracted from quarries. The method of extraction depends on the intended use. If for cement manufacture , or road metal, then blasting and crushing are appropriate. ... Quarrying is the extraction of rocks and other materials from the earths surface by blasting.

The type of finish on a limestone surface can also impact on the level of staining. Bush-hammered limestone is more likely to be stained than other finishes. This is because in order to give the stone that rough look pieces of the surface are removed by hammering, allowing liquids an …

Limestone is classed as a sedimentary rock. It was formed on the surface of the Earth by the process of sedimentation, with several minerals or organic particles coming together to form a solid sediment. Limestone is formed from at least 50 per cent calcium carbonate.

and limestone bedrock are close to the land surface. But at eight locations across the state (Jasper, Louisa, Marion, Poweshiek, Scott, Story, Van Buren, and Webster counties), where geologic and market conditions permit, limestone for aggregate is extracted from underground mines.

The deposit of sub-surface limestone was first discovered at a depth of 1967m below the surface at Kuchma of Bogra district when Standard Vacuum Oil Company was drilling for oil. Later, in 1964 GSP (under UNPAK mineral survey project) investigated detail geological and geophysical surveys in the area and found Eocene limestone in the region.

The Jura Grey is a grey coloured limestone, with thin to medium stone and non-uniform background.This limestone is mostly known by the presence of strong signs of fossils with darker colour, sparsely distributed throughout the stone surface. It may present some grey colour variation.. The Jura Grey is a reference grey limestone from Germany, with considerable hardness.
